It is a high-performance 50-ohm low-loss coaxial cable specifically designed for indoor plenum environments, such as air-handling spaces ceilings and raised floors. It provides performance comparable to corrugated copper cables while offering greater flexibility for easier routing and installation. It features a fire-retardant, low-smoke jacket, making it compliant with strict safety standards like CMP/FT6 ratings.
This cable is constructed with a bare copper conductor, aluminum foil shield, and tinned braid, ensuring excellent signal integrity minimal RF loss.
